你有一个长度为 n 的队伍,从左到右依次为 1~n,有 m 次插队行为,用数组 cutIn 进行表示,cutIn 的元素依次代表想要插队的人的编号,每次插队,这个人都会直接移动到队伍的最前方。你需要返回一个整数,代表这 m 次插队行为之后,有多少个人已经不在原来队伍的位置了。
3,[3, 2, 3]
2
初始队伍为 [1, 2, 3]3 开始插队 [3, 1, 2]2 开始插队 [2, 3, 1]3 开始插队 [3, 2, 1]所以2还在原来的尾置,3和1两个人已经不在原来的位置了。
3,[]
0
没有人进行插队,所有人都在自己原来的位置上。
对于所有数据,保证 , ,且
这道题你会答吗?花几分钟告诉大家答案吧!